Finding a co-signer with a good credit history can significantly improve your chances of getting approved for a home loan. A co-signer agrees to take responsibility for the loan, which provides additional assurance to the lender.
A larger down payment can mitigate some risk for lenders, making them more willing to approve your loan. Aim for at least 20% of the home’s purchase price to demonstrate your commitment and financial stability.
Establishing a relationship with a local lender can be beneficial. Schedule a meeting and discuss your situation openly. Local lenders might offer more flexibility than larger banks, so they could be more willing to work with you.

Seek pre-approval to gauge your eligibility. This step gives you a clearer understanding of what you can afford and showcases to sellers that you are a serious buyer. Pre-approval letters can make your offer much more appealing.
Understanding the terms of your mortgage is crucial. Be aware of the interest rates, loan duration, and any fees involved. This knowledge will empower you to make informed decisions as you navigate the loan process.
Illinois offers various first-time homebuyer programs that provide financial assistance and information for buyers without established credit. Research available programs, grants, and down payment assistance options.
